Bluetooth headsets aren’t exactly the most desirable devices to own in the world, but then again, they are a necessity in urban environments – simply because it is dangerous to drive while talking or texting on the phone. Sound ID knows this, and decided to come up with the Sound ID Six that is touted to “redefine the Bluetooth headset experience.”

Boasting a contemporary design and innovative functionality, the Six has been represented to be the most advanced headset on the market today, although I am not quite sure whether other notable Bluetooth headset manufacturers will dispute this or not. Other features which can be customized and extended using the free unique EarPrint 3.0 app will be able to enable users to personalize the headset’s sound settings right from one’s smartphone in a convenient manner.

Other features include VoiceMenu, ActiveConnect, Clear Carbon Smart Touch Surface, 3X NoiseNavigation, RealComfort EarLoops 2.0, an On/Off Switch, and a Pass Thru Mode. Will you be picking it up for $129.99 a pop?
